The walking calorie calculator uses a mathematical formula to estimate the calories burned. Calculation includes body weight, metabolic equivalents (METs), walking speed, and time spent walking. The formula multiplies these variables to provide an estimation of the energy expenditure in calories.
The formula for calculating the walking calories are Calorie(Kcal) = BMR x Mets / 24 x hour Excess calorie (Average) = calorie intake−calorie burned The Walking Calorie Calculator calculates the burning calories on the basis of the BMR and MET calories of walking by considering the above equation.
3 dni temu · Use the following formulas to calculate the stride and the walked distance. stride = height × 0.414. distance = stride × steps. Calculate the walking time: time = distance/speed. Finally, count the calories burned: calories = time × MET × 3.5 × weight/(200 × 60)
